feat(tui): implement Emacs-style kill ring for Editor
Add kill ring functionality with: - Ctrl+W/U/K save deleted text to kill ring - Ctrl+Y yanks (pastes) most recent deletion - Alt+Y cycles through kill ring (after Ctrl+Y) - Consecutive deletions accumulate into single entry

/**
|
||||
* Yank (paste) the most recent kill ring entry at cursor position.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
private yank(): void {
|
||||
if (this.killRing.length === 0) return;
|
||||
|
||||
const text = this.killRing[this.killRing.length - 1] || "";
|
||||
this.insertYankedText(text);
|
||||
|
||||
this.lastAction = "yank";
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Cycle through kill ring (only works immediately after yank or yank-pop).
|
||||
* Replaces the last yanked text with the previous entry in the ring.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
private yankPop(): void {
|
||||
// Only works if we just yanked and have more than one entry
|
||||
if (this.lastAction !== "yank" || this.killRing.length <= 1) return;
|
||||
|
||||
// Delete the previously yanked text (still at end of ring before rotation)
|
||||
this.deleteYankedText();
|
||||
|
||||
// Rotate the ring: move end to front
|
||||
const lastEntry = this.killRing.pop();
|
||||
assert(lastEntry !== undefined); // Since killRing was not empty
|
||||
this.killRing.unshift(lastEntry);
|
||||
|
||||
// Insert the new most recent entry (now at end after rotation)
|
||||
const text = this.killRing[this.killRing.length - 1];
|
||||
this.insertYankedText(text);
|
||||
|
||||
this.lastAction = "yank";
|
||||
}

/**
|
||||
* Add text to the kill ring.
|
||||
* If lastAction is "kill", accumulates with the previous entry.
|
||||
* @param text - The text to add
|
||||
* @param prepend - If accumulating, prepend (true) or append (false) to existing entry
|
||||
*/
|
||||
private addToKillRing(text: string, prepend: boolean): void {
|
||||
if (!text) return;
|
||||
|
||||
if (this.lastAction === "kill" && this.killRing.length > 0) {
|
||||
// Accumulate with the most recent entry (at end of array)
|
||||
const lastEntry = this.killRing.pop();
|
||||
if (prepend) {
|
||||
this.killRing.push(text + lastEntry);
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
this.killRing.push(lastEntry + text);
|
||||
}
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
// Add new entry to end of ring
|
||||
this.killRing.push(text);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
